Output d28afdb84b920d59c71a0cdae4f044c2345c2b572b68fab0c21cfc591623f3eb:0

value
26453690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b1703d34a9d5754a4b40d0c4a7f86dfdd69078 OP_EQUAL
address
3PuYgoBbfepPvRV1NrPEi9osQd4y1DTczL
transaction
d28afdb84b920d59c71a0cdae4f044c2345c2b572b68fab0c21cfc591623f3eb